However if this health risk data is extracted from its original COMPOSITION context, for example, to be included in a discharge summary or message then the temporal context is effectively removed if the archetype is used within another COMPOSITION. This 'Last updated' data element has been explicitly added to allow the critical temporal data to be kept alongside the clinical data in all circumstances. It is assumed that the clinical system can copy the date from the COMPOSITION to reduce the need for duplication of data entry by the clincian."> > ["at0025"] = < text = <"Assessment method"> description = <"Identification of the algorithm or guideline used to make the assessment of risk."> comment = <"For example: Framingham cardiovascular risk calculator."> > ["at0026"] = < text = <"Indeterminate"> description = <"It is not possible to determine if the risk factor is present or absent."> > ["at0027"] = < text = <"Detail"> description = <"Structured detail about other aspects of the risk factor assessment."> comment = <"For example: Prevalence of the risk factor in family members."> > ["at0028"] = < text = <"Mitigated"> description = <"The risk factor has been identified as present, but then subsequently been mitigated by treatment or investigation."> comment = <"Record as True if the risk factor has been treated or investigated and risk from this risk factor is considered to be lessened. For example: an infant given gentamicin in neonatal intensive care is regarded as having a risk of permanent hearing loss. If diagnostic testing shows no evidence of hearing loss in the first year of life, the risk of later hearing loss is considered to be much reduced, but still possible. This data element allows clinicians to say that the risk has been mitigated but should still be considered as a possibility in future. In practice, the risk factor could be maintained in the risk assessment in case it might impact the individual's health at a future time, but flagging that its contribution to risk calculation may not be as great as if it had not been previously treated or investigated.
